About

The investigators will develop an artificial intelligence model to predict left ventricular ejection fraction using chest radiographic images and transthoracic echocardiography data.

Full description

Echocardiography should be considered at an early stage in patients who have first developed heart failure or who do not have information about heart function, but the examination may be delayed due to lack of time and manpower in the actual medical field.

Primary Objective: Use chest radiographs to predict the left ventricular ejection fraction

Inclusion criteria

  • Adults who are 20 years and older
  • Patient who visited the emergency room or outpatient clinic due to dyspnea and chest pain

Exclusion criteria

  • Patient refusal
  • Uncertain radiographs or transthoracic echocardiography
  • Uncertain tests results
